Latest Patents
Sefalidis holds a patent for a "Sorption column for waste-gas cleaning." This invention features a sorption column that includes at least one vat containing a solid stationary sorbent. The design incorporates a lower gas connecting piece and an upper gas connecting piece. The lower gas connecting piece is equipped with a coupling member, allowing for efficient gas flow management. The vat is designed to be placed on the lower gas connecting piece, featuring valves in both its cover and bottom. These valves open when joined with the coupling member, creating a gas space that facilitates communication between the lower and upper gas connecting pieces. This innovative design enhances the efficiency of waste-gas cleaning processes.
